Enzyme Information

1.1.1.305
UDP-glucuronic acid oxidase (UDP-4-keto-hexauronic acid decarboxylating).
based on mapping to UniProt P77398
UDP-alpha-D-glucuronate + NAD(+) = UDP-beta-L-threo-pentapyranos-4-ulose + CO(2) + NADH.
-!- The activity is part of a bifunctional enzyme also performing the reaction of EC 2.1.2.13. -!- Formerly EC 1.1.1.n1.
2.1.2.13
UDP-4-amino-4-deoxy-L-arabinose formyltransferase.
based on mapping to UniProt P77398
10-formyltetrahydrofolate + UDP-4-amino-4-deoxy-beta-L-arabinose = 5,6,7,8-tetrahydrofolate + UDP-4-deoxy-4-formamido-beta-L-arabinose.
-!- The activity is part of a bifunctional enzyme also performing the reaction of EC 1.1.1.305. -!- Formerly EC 2.1.2.n1.
